Joshua “Josh” Weitz Gill, Sr., 44, passed away Wednesday, June 28, 2023 after a boating accident in Midway, Georgia.
Josh was born April 13, 1979 in Savannah, Georgia to the late, William Alfred and Regina Miller Gill. He attended school in the Richmond Hill area. After high school Josh went into the construction business. Josh was considered to be one of the best in his trade. He took pride in his work and enjoyed showing the finished product to his friends and family. Josh was an avid outdoorsman and a thrill seeker. He enjoyed fishing, 4-wheeling, grilling and was considered by many to be a master chef. Josh will be greatly missed and remembered by his family, friends, and many coworkers he met along the way.
Josh is survived by his wife, Kimberly Gill; his children, Joshua Gill, Jr., Noah Gill and Skylar Gill; his sisters, Melanie Bly and Hope Bailey (Donnie) and many extended family members and close friends.
A memorial service will be held on Friday, July 7, 2023 at 7:00 pm at Thomas L. Carter Funeral Home, Flemington, with Pastor Brenda Crawford officiating.
Thomas L. Carter Funeral Home, Flemington, is handling the arrangements.
